Overview
74HCT165PW-Q100 from Nexperia is an automotive-grade 8-bit parallel-in/serial-out shift register with TTL-compatible inputs, asynchronous parallel load (PL), complementary serial outputs (Q7 and Q7), and clock enable (CE) control. It operates from -40 °C to +125 °C, supports 4.5–5.5 V supply, and delivers 26 MHz max clock frequency at VCC = 4.5 V - used in automotive body control modules for GPIO expansion via SPI-compatible serial interfaces.

Technical Context
This device implements a synchronous 8-stage shift register with asynchronous parallel load capability. Its functional architecture allows simultaneous capture of 8-bit parallel data on PL low, followed by serial shifting on CP rising edges when CE is low - enabling deterministic latency control in time-critical automotive subsystems.
The dual complementary outputs (Q7 and Q7) provide matched propagation delays (≤ 43 ns at VCC = 4.5 V) and transition times (≤ 22 ns), while input overvoltage tolerance (15 V) permits robust level-shifting between higher-voltage sensors and 5 V microcontroller domains without external protection circuitry.

Pinout & Package
TSSOP16 plastic thin shrink small outline package (SOT403-1); 16 leads; body width 4.4 mm; side-wettable flanks for automated optical inspection of solder joints.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| 1 (PL) | Asynchronous parallel load input | Active-LOW signal that latches D0–D7 into register immediately - enables instant state capture independent of clock. |
| 2 (CP) | Clock input | LOW-to-HIGH edge-triggered; controls serial shift timing - synchronized with system master clock domain. |
| 7 (Q7) | Serial output | MSB output after 8 shifts; drives downstream logic or microcontroller MISO line directly. |
| 9 (Q7) | Complementary serial output | Inverted Q7 signal - supports differential sensing or noise-immune routing in noisy automotive environments. |
| 10 (DS) | Serial data input | Accepts serial data during shift mode; sampled on CP rising edge when CE = LOW. |
| 11–14, 3–6 (D0–D7) | Parallel data inputs | 8-bit wide bus for loading sensor status, switch states, or configuration bits in one cycle. |
| 15 (CE) | Clock enable input | Active-LOW gate for CP - halts shifting without clock gating, preserving internal state during idle periods. |
| 16 (VCC) | Positive supply | 5 V nominal rail; decoupling required within 10 mm for stable switching performance. |
| 8 (GND) | Ground reference | 0 V return path; must be low-impedance connection to minimize ground bounce in multi-stage daisy chains. |

Equivalent & Alternatives
The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ar parallel-in/serial-out shift register applications.
| Alternative Part | Technical Difference | Application Difference | Selection Advice |
|---|---|---|---|
| 74HC165PW-Q100 | CMOS input thresholds (VIH ≥ 3.15 V @ VCC = 4.5 V); lower ICC (8 μA typical) but incompatible with TTL logic levels. | Suitable only where driving source is CMOS-compatible; not recommended for legacy 5 V TTL systems. | Select when system uses pure CMOS logic and ultra-low static current is critical - not for mixed-signal or TTL-interfaced designs. |
| SN74LV165APWR | Lower voltage range (2–5.5 V); LV logic family; no AEC-Q100 qualification; 32 MHz fmax at 5 V. | Targeted at industrial/commercial applications; lacks automotive temperature range and qualification documentation. | Choose for cost-sensitive non-automotive designs requiring wider VCC range or higher speed - not for automotive production programs. |
Compared with 74HC165PW-Q100 and SN74LV165APWR, the 74HCT165PW-Q100 uniquely combines TTL-level compatibility, AEC-Q100 Grade 1 qualification, and side-wettable TSSOP packaging - making it the only option qualified for safety-critical automotive serial GPIO expansion where legacy 5 V logic interoperability is mandatory.

FAQ
What is the maximum clock frequency supported by the 74HCT165PW-Q100?
The 74HCT165PW-Q100 supports a maximum clock frequency of 26 MHz at VCC = 4.5 V and -40 °C to +125 °C ambient. At 5.0 V and CL = 15 pF, the datasheet specifies 48 MHz - but this higher value applies only under controlled lab conditions and is not guaranteed across the full automotive temperature range.
Can the 74HCT165PW-Q100 interface directly with 12 V sensors?
Yes - all inputs are overvoltage tolerant up to 15 V, allowing direct connection to 12 V automotive sensor outputs without external clamping diodes or level-shifters. This capability is validated across the full -40 °C to +125 °C operating range and is part of its AEC-Q100 qualification test plan.
Does the 74HCT165PW-Q100 require external pull-up or pull-down resistors on control pins?
No - the PL, CE, and CP inputs have no internal pull resistors, but their DC input leakage current is ≤ ±1 μA across temperature, so external biasing is only needed if signal sources are high-impedance or floating. In standard 5 V CMOS/TTL driving configurations, no external resistors are required.
How does the complementary Q7 and Q7 output functionality improve noise immunity?
The matched propagation delay (≤ 43 ns) and transition time (≤ 22 ns) between Q7 and Q7 enable differential signaling techniques - such as XOR-based clock/data recovery or common-mode noise rejection - without external components. This reduces susceptibility to EMI in high-noise automotive harness environments.
